Transformers: Good News/Bad News
First, the bad news… it looks like Robot Heroes may have joined Adventure Heroes, M-Pire and Toy Box Heroes in the Hasbro Heroes graveyard. Normanb258 shared this over on the message board but apparently Parry Game Preserve asked a very delicate question regarding Robot Heroes, and got a sad answer:
Preserve: Do you plan to continue the Robot Heroes line beyond the current movie figures?
Hasbro: We do not have any plans to continue with this expression of Transformers past the ROTF line.

G.I. Joe’s Potential Return to TV
Hasbro and Discovery Communications are apparently doing a handshake that results in a joint media venture, that will itself result in a TV channel and website devoted to programming. What kind of programming?
New programming will be based on brands such as ROMPER ROOM, TRIVIAL PURSUIT, SCRABBLE, CRANIUM, MY LITTLE PONY, G.I. JOE, GAME OF LIFE, TONKA and TRANSFORMERS, among many others. The TV network and online presence also will include content from Discovery’s extensive library of award-winning children’s educational programming, such as BINDI THE JUNGLE GIRL, ENDURANCE, TUTENSTEIN, HI-5, FLIGHT 29 DOWN and PEEP AND THE BIG WIDE WORLD, as well as programming from third-party producers.
and further down the article:
Creative work will start in the next few months beginning with early stage development for properties including ROMPER ROOM, TONKA, G.I. JOE, TRANSFORMERS and MY LITTLE PONY. The creative team will have the capability to produce animated, live-action, and game show programming as well as content designed for digital and mobile extensions.
Given that Discovery Kids is already on many cable packages and airs Discovery’s “extensive” line of programming, it’ll be interesting to see whether this new network is in addition to, or in place of, Discovery Kids.
